Skylark

By . 9 cassettes or 9 CDs. 11 hrs. Recorded Books. 2012. cassette: ISBN 978-1-4618-4477-8. CD: ISBN 978-1-4618-5576-1. $97.75.

Gr 7 Up—Following a cataclysmic war, a great dome powered by human magic was erected to protect survivors. Just outside this barrier stretches an uninhabitable and dangerous wasteland. This is what the Institute, the City's governing body, strictly maintains. When Lark Ainsley, 16, is chosen to have her magic harvested, she discovers this seemingly benign rite of passage is nothing like she expected. Following a series of terrifying ordeals, the teen learns of her rare ability to regenerate magic. Her fate is to become a living battery used to power the Wall. Horrified, Lark escapes and flees into the unknown world beyond the City's boundary. Pursued by the Institute and accompanied by two unlikely traveling companions, Lark journeys across a landscape both treacherous and wondrous seeking the rumored existence of other Renewables. She also hopes to learn what happened to her brother, who mysteriously vanished years earlier. But nothing is as it seems. Is Lark prepared to handle the terrible deceptions her quest eventually uncovers? More importantly, who can she trust? The debut (Carolrhoda, 2012) of Spooner's exciting new trilogy artfully marries elements of dystopian, sci-fi, and steampunk to create a hauntingly mesmerizing story that's sure to strike a chord with fans of all three genres. The author's knack for world-building and character development, combined with a unique plot and first-person narrative, makes this story impossible to put down. These qualities are further enhanced by Angela Lin's emotion-charged reading and spot-on portrayals. Purchase along with the print format—it's sure to popular.—Alissa Bach, Oxford Public Library, MI
